Product details

The new Hoya Instant Action magnetic filter holder system allows normal screw-on filters to be magnetically mounted to the lens. Save a lot of time changing filters with the Hoya Instant Action System so you never miss that one moment again. Here's how it works: 1. screw the Hoya Instant Action Adapter Ring onto your lens - it can stay permanently on the lens. 2. screw the separately available Hoya Instant Action Adapter Ring onto your lens. 2. screw the Hoya Instant Action Conversion Ring, sold separately, onto your screw-on filter. 3. Now you can magnetically attach the filter to the lens. Since the Hoya Instant Action System is used with the filter, the entire frame will be thicker. Please note that this may cause vignetting on APS-C wide-angle lenses with a focal length of less than 14mm and on full-frame wide-angle lenses with a focal length of less than 20mm.
